Description
An automotive polisher restores and enhances vehicle finishes by buffing, polishing, and waxing surfaces to remove imperfections like scratches and swirls. A job description includes washing, decontaminating, and preparing vehicles, using specialized tools and products for a high-gloss finish, and applying protective coatings. Key requirements are attention to detail, knowledge of polishing techniques, physical stamina, and customer service skills.
Key responsibilities
- Inspect vehicle surfaces for damage and imperfections.
- Wash, decontaminate, and prepare vehicles for polishing.
- Select and use appropriate polishing compounds, pads, and tools to remove scratches, swirl marks, and oxidation.
- Apply protective coatings such as wax or sealants.
- Perform quality control checks to ensure a flawless finish.
- Maintain polishing equipment and order supplies as needed.
- Work with other team members, such as detailers and painters, to ensure vehicles are ready on time.
